Ian Nicholson is a robotics engineer whose work bridges the gap between autonomous systems and critical industrial inspection. His research focuses on developing robotic platforms for non-destructive evaluation (NDE) in harsh environments, particularly for the aerospace and offshore oil and gas sectors. A key contribution is his pioneering work on an unmanned underwater robotic crawler designed to operate on subsea flexible risers—a vital tool for the oil industry, enabling equipment transport and inspection in deep-sea conditions. This work, detailed in his 2010 paper (7 citations), addresses the challenge of maintaining infrastructure in inaccessible locations. Nicholson also contributed to the IntACom project (2013, 5 citations), which developed a fast inspection system for aerospace composite materials, supporting the industry's shift toward lighter, more durable structures. His most cited work, "Robotic non-destructive inspection" (2012, 9 citations), lays the groundwork for automated defect detection. With a career focused on practical, deployable solutions, Nicholson’s research has direct implications for safety and efficiency in high-stakes industries, making him a notable figure in applied robotics and NDE.
